United Steel Structural Co

From Graces Guide
July 1961.

1951 One of the companies nationalised as part of the nationalisation of the iron and steel industry[1]

1954 One of the United Steel companies returned to private ownership[2]

1959 Replaced the steelwork contractors on the Barton High Level bridge across the Manchester Ship Canal; 2 men were killed and 8 injured when steel girders collapsed soon after work resumed[3]
